Anni Albers Fabric Collection by Christopher Farr Cloth
One of the most influential textile artists of the 20th century, Anni Albers began her career at the Bauhaus, where – prevented from studying other disciplines as a woman – she took up weaving under the tutelage of Gunta Stölz. This kickstarted a lifelong passion for the tactile and aesthetic possibilities of textiles, eventually becoming the most famous weaver of the modern age. Christopher Farr Cloth takes inspiration from her designs and reinterprets them as a collection of beautiful prints all on 100% linen.
